We are seeking Digital Product Engineer Principals in Eagan, MN to be accountable for the design, development, delivery, and support of modern digital products including web, mobile, IoT, and microservice based backends. The role is accountable for the full product life cycle and for the full technology stack. Technologies leveraged may include but are not limited to Terraform, Python, or Bash & Powershell scripts, Lambda, and the full suite of AWS products.

Your Responsibilities:

  • Design, develop, code, and test of digital products.
  • Design, develop, configure, support AWS platform.
  • Lead system designs and technology platform decisions.
  • Keep abreast of industry trends and present findings to team, leadership, and stakeholders.
  • Mentor and train fellow team members on technologies, design patterns, and best practices.
  • Participate on and lead Agile teams of skilled developers / engineers, testers, and analysists.
  • Contribute to product development.
  • Continuous Integration / Continuous Deploy lifecycle.
  • Work closely with business stakeholders to plan product features, stories.
  • Work creatively and collaboratively with to ensure product usability, usefulness, feasibility, and cost effectiveness.
  • Ensure team members have tools, time, and resources they need to successfully deliver and support solutions

Required Skills and Experience: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, Electronics Engineering or related field followed by seven (7) years of software development / software engineering experience.
  • 5 years of experience with AWS Infrastructure and services including EC2, ECS, RDS, and Lambda, and full stack serverless products.
  • 3 years of experience in developing modern technology with Terraform, Python, or Bash & Powershell scripts.
  • 3 years of experience with modern development and collaboration tools Jira, CodeCommit, CodePipeline, and CodeDeploy.
  • 3 years of experience delivering products using agile and DevOps methodologies.
  • Cloud Service Provider Certification (e.g., AWS Cloud Practitioner, Azure Fundamentals, or similar).

Compensation and Benefits:

Pay Range: $117,800.00 - $159,000.00 - $200,200.00 Annual

Pay is based on several factors which vary based on position, including skills, ability, and knowledge the selected individual is bringing to the specific job.

We offer a comprehensive benefits package which may include:

  • Medical, dental, and vision insurance
  • Life insurance
  • 401k
  • Paid Time Off (PTO)
  • Volunteer Paid Time Off (VPTO)
  • And more
